Root canal treatment, also known as endodontic treatment, is a common dental procedure aimed at saving a severely damaged or infected tooth. Dental clinics often provide root canal services, and it is typically performed by a general dentist or an endodontist (a dentist who specializes in root canal treatments and related procedures).


Here’s what you can expect when getting a root canal treatment at a dental clinic:
If you have severe tooth pain, sensitivity, or signs of infection, your dentist will conduct a thorough examination and may take X-rays to assess the issue. Before the procedure begins, Dr. Vikas Gupta numbs the area around the affected tooth with a local anesthetic to ensure you are comfortable during the treatment.
Vikas Gupta will create a small access hole in the crown of the tooth to reach the infected or damaged pulp.
Using specialized dental tools, Dr. Vikas will carefully remove the infected or damaged pulp from the inside of the tooth and clean the root canals to ensure no bacteria or debris remain.
After cleaning and shaping the root canals, Dr. Gupta will fill them with a rubber-like material called gutta-percha. This material seals the canals to prevent further infection.
In most cases, a tooth that undergoes root canal treatment becomes more fragile, so a dental crown is usually placed on top of the tooth to provide strength, protection, and aesthetics.
After the root canal treatment is complete, you may need to schedule a follow-up appointment to ensure the tooth is healing properly and the infection has been eliminated.
